Algebraic relations between sine and cosine values
Abstract
The aim of this note is to show that any algebraic relation over Q between the values of the trigonometric functions sine and cosine at algebraic points can be derived from the Pythagorean identity and the angle addition formulas. This result is obtained as a consequence of the Lindemann-Weierstrass theorem.
